This is probably super easy, but this is my first dive into crowds and I can't for the life of me get it to work.

All I'm trying to do is have several pieces of geo and have the agents, just wonder around on top of them. Turn before going off the edge.

Currently my approach is build walls around all of the pieces and then use a popsteerobstacle, but that only kinda works, I still have agents going off, and then sometimes they start floating in the air.

What is the right way to do this?

You could try scattering points on your pieces and then use a PopSteerSeek to have agents seek those goal points.Once they reach the goal then what? If you don't have a state for that consider adding one, like idle. Or regenerate a new goal on the piece and have them walk to that.

There is a Street Example that ships with Houdini, under the Crowds shelf. Maybe there are some tips in there that can help you out?
